Country policy

This country policy is for companies who want to export. For each country, a country policy has been established that applies to all export transactions insured by Atradius.

The country policy for medium term transactions applies to Dutch export transactions only. Country ceilings are generally applied for medium term business. The capacity under the country ceilings is updated and published monthly on this site. Promises of Cover are booked under the relevant country ceiling for 100% of their value; policies are booked for their full value.

The maximum percentage covered is 95. For cover on buyers in industrialised countries, however, this percentage is in general maximised to 90. The maximum percentage for political risk may be 98. In addition, reduced percentages of cover may apply to buyers in a certain number of countries. This is specified on the relevant country pages.

Country facts

On a number of important export markets, Atradius has put together some facts, based on recent data. These facts can be found, if available, next to the country policy of the relevant countries. Economic changes may, however, take place faster than the site is updated. Therefore, facts might have changed in the meantime.
